Output 26f2624f5d9dd56a7343fd2dde19e569e208a82ef5ea00aebbe37eeac70944ce:1

value
386396446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d47473b25c60012788d71b6349cb635643f6b4 OP_EQUAL
address
33E1FEjavbxCo65mTSLpYmuZM8AGXZaiwT
transaction
26f2624f5d9dd56a7343fd2dde19e569e208a82ef5ea00aebbe37eeac70944ce
confirmations
430372
spent
true